Output ea11a2b54dbfcb128bd4e6da66c9cc636df2ad78d27aff033a4bfbaf56e19bb8:1

value
506546
script pubkey
OP_0 OP_PUSHBYTES_20 af657ea81c494427e4c4ececaa64dd6016cc9008
address
bc1q4ajha2quf9zz0exyank25exavqtveyqg8ag7pt
transaction
ea11a2b54dbfcb128bd4e6da66c9cc636df2ad78d27aff033a4bfbaf56e19bb8
confirmations
18823
spent
true